What it is, How it works

Hair analysis emerges as an efficient resource for monitoring drug and alcohol intake. By embedding biomarkers within the fibers of developing hair strands, hair offers an extensive retrospective view of alcohol and other drugs. When procured near the scalp, hair affords a detection timeframe of up to around 90 days for alcohol and other substances. It is easy to gather, difficult to tamper with, and simple to transport.

A 1.5-inch section comprising roughly 200 hair strands (similar in size to a #2 pencil) nearest to the scalp yields 100mg of hair, which is the optimal quantity for analysis and verification. For EtG, additional evaluations, and/or analyses beyond 10 panels, a specimen of 150mg is advocated. The specimen should be weighed using a jeweler’s scale. If scalp hair cannot be obtained, a comparable amount of body hair may be used. When we mention head hair, we specifically mean scalp hair. Body hair pertains to all other hair types (facial, axillary, etc.).

Process Overview

The laboratory procedure for deriving a drug test result encompasses four primary stages: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ning covers the initial sample handling within the laboratory’s framework. This consists of confirming that the sample was properly sealed and shipped, allocating a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and finalizing any extra data entry not included in an electronic chain of custody system.

Screening entails an initial rapid examination for substances of abuse. While Screening offers a cost-efficient means to eliminate drug use for the majority of samples, a positive outcome requires confirmation to be valid in legal contexts. Samples indicating likely positive in Screening necessitate further confirmation.

If Screening suggests a positive result, additional hair is extracted from the original specimen for Extraction. This phase involves extracting substances from hair at significantly lower concentrations than those achieved by other techniques (such as urine or oral fluid), underscoring the complexity of hair drug screening.

Any positive results from Screening undergo Confirmation using G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S. All samples suggesting positive are cleansed before confirmation as needed. The complete lab process from Accessioning to Confirmation adheres to both the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air designation and accreditation to ISO / IEC 17025 standards.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Extended detection timeframe: Hair drug assessments can identify drug use for a duration of up to 90 days, contrasting with the narrower timeframe of urine tests.
  • Challenging to falsify: Hair drug assessments are difficult to manipulate, ensuring more precise outcomes.
  • Supplies historical insight: It offers a record of drug usage over an interval, not merely recent usage.

Limitations:

  • Incapable of detecting recent usage: Detectability in hair requires approximately 5-7 days post-drug intake.
  • Expense: Hair drug assessments tend to be pricier than alternative drug screening techniques.
  • Results variability: Factors like hair color and personal differences in hair growth may influence drug metabolite levels in hair.

Note: Although commonly termed "hair follicle tests", the evaluation pertains to the hair strand and excludes the follicle beneath the scalp.

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

Frequently Asked Questions

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
Yes. If the donor's head hair is too short or unavailable, body hair may be collected as an alternative. The collector will document the source of the sample. This allows testing even for individuals with recently cut or shaved head hair.
